This review is from: Healing the Gender Wars: Therapy with Men and Couples (Hardcover)
For most men, the transition into the new world of women's equal rights has not been easy. In the modern family, women expect to be genuine partners. They feel emboldened to express desires and expect satisfaction of emotional and sexual needs. Many men feel conflicted about sharing responsibilities with women, and may be frightened by women's assertiveness and more open sexuality. Some men even feel like wimps if they follow - rather than ignite - their partner's desires. A kind of gender war often develops in which neither partner feels heard or satisfied. With many compelling examples and the lens of contemporary object relations theory, Dr. Samuel Slipp shows readers how individual and couples therapy can lead to happier lives for men and the women thay love.
